Stone masonry repair services involve the restoration and reinforcement of existing stone structures to address issues such as deterioration, cracking, or structural instability. Skilled professionals assess the condition of the stonework, identify areas that require attention, and employ specialized techniques to repair or replace damaged stones. These services often include repointing mortar joints, cleaning and sealing stone surfaces, and rebuilding sections that have experienced significant wear or damage. The goal is to preserve the integrity and appearance of the original stonework while ensuring its long-term stability.
This type of repair service helps resolve common problems like cracking, spalling, and erosion caused by weathering, moisture infiltration, or age-related deterioration. Over time, natural elements can weaken mortar joints and cause stones to loosen or crack, which may compromise the safety and aesthetic value of a structure. Addressing these issues promptly through professional stone masonry repair can prevent further damage, reduce the risk of structural failure, and maintain the property's overall appearance.

Labor Costs - Typically range from $40 to $70 per hour for skilled stone masons. Total costs depend on project size and complexity, with small repairs often costing a few hundred dollars. Larger restoration projects may require several thousand dollars in labor expenses.
Material Expenses - The cost of stone materials varies widely, from $10 to $50 per square foot. The choice of stone type and quality influences overall expenses, with custom or rare stones increasing costs. Material prices are a significant factor in the total project budget.
Scope of Repair - Minor crack repairs may cost between $200 and $800, while extensive rebuilding can range from $2,000 to over $10,000. The extent of damage and repair complexity directly impact overall costs. A detailed assessment by local pros can provide more accurate estimates.
Additional Charges - Extra costs may include surface cleaning, sealing, or structural reinforcement, which can add $100 to $1,000 or more.
